关闭Linux的防火墙:一个安全操作的指南

1. 介绍

安全是每个操作系统用户都应该关注的重要问题。在Linux系统中,有防火墙来帮助保护网络安全。然而,有时候关闭防火墙可能是必需的,可能是为了进行特定的测试或配置其他安全措施。本文将向您介绍如何在Linux系统中关闭防火墙。

2. 了解Linux防火墙

在关闭防火墙之前,了解一下Linux防火墙的基本原理非常重要。Linux防火墙使用iptables命令来管理和配置网络防火墙规则。这些规则决定了网络数据包如何进入和离开系统。iptables命令是一个强大的工具,可以用于过滤、重定向和修改网络数据包。

2.1 iptables命令简介

iptables命令的基本语法如下:

iptables [-t 表名] 命令 [链名] 条件 [动作]

其中,表名指定了要操作的表,常见的表包括filter、nat和mangle。而命令则指定了要执行的动作,常见的命令有-A(添加规则)、-D(删除规则)、-I(插入规则)等。

了解了iptables命令的基本语法,我们可以继续学习如何关闭Linux防火墙。

3. 关闭Linux防火墙

3.1 检查防火墙状态

在关闭防火墙之前,我们首先需要检查防火墙的当前状态。可以使用以下命令来检查防火墙是否已经启用:

sudo iptables -L

如果命令的输出结果中显示有防火墙规则,则说明防火墙已经启用;如果输出结果为空,则说明防火墙已关闭。

3.2 关闭防火墙

要关闭防火墙,可以使用以下命令:

sudo iptables -F

该命令将清空防火墙规则。执行此命令后,如果再次执行sudo iptables -L命令,输出结果应为空。

如果需要关闭特定表的防火墙(如nat表),可以使用以下命令:

sudo iptables -t 表名 -F

3.3 永久关闭防火墙

上述操作只会在系统重启后才会生效。如果希望永久关闭防火墙,需要将防火墙服务禁用。具体的操作方法取决于您使用的Linux发行版。

例如,在Ubuntu中,可以使用以下命令禁用防火墙:

sudo systemctl stop iptables

sudo systemctl disable iptables

4. 结论

关闭Linux防火墙可能是必需的,但是请谨慎操作。在执行任何与网络安全相关的操作之前,请确保自己清楚明白所做的每一步,以免出现安全漏洞。希望本文能够帮助您了解如何关闭Linux防火墙,并为您提供有关防火墙操作的基本知识。

操作系统标签